Why Zinc Citrate Supplements Are in High Demand
Zinc citrate is a highly absorbable form of zinc, making it a preferred choice for dietary supplements. It supports immune function, skin health, and cognitive performance, aligning with the increasing focus on preventive healthcare. Countries with aging populations and rising health consciousness, such as the U.S., Europe, and Japan, are major importers of zinc citrate supplements.

Key Export Markets for Zinc Citrate Supplements
1. North America – The U.S. and Canada have a strong demand for immune-boosting supplements, driven by health-conscious consumers.
2. Europe – Strict regulations ensure high-quality supplement standards, making zinc citrate a sought-after ingredient.
3. Asia-Pacific – Countries like Japan, South Korea, and Australia are experiencing rapid growth in dietary supplement consumption.
4. Middle East & Africa – Increasing disposable income and healthcare awareness are boosting supplement imports.

How to Succeed in Zinc Citrate Supplement Exports
– Compliance with Regulations – Ensure products meet FDA, EFSA, and other regional standards.
– Quality Certifications – Obtain GMP, ISO, or Halal/Kosher certifications to enhance marketability.
– Strategic Partnerships – Collaborate with distributors and e-commerce platforms to expand reach.
